Diana Block, co-publisher and president of the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ette, has stepped down from her day-to-day role at the newspaper.
Christopher H. Chamberlain, the general manager of the Post-Gazette, has been promoted to president, and will be in charge of daily operations. He was hired last spring from the Journal Register Co. of Connecticut.
Ms. Block had succeeded former Post-Gazette president David Beihoff, who retired in July 2008. She said she wanted to spend more time with her children.
"It is with mixed emotions, however, that I step out of the daily operations and relationships that I've enjoyed so much at the PG," she said in a statement released yesterday.
Ms. Block will continue to serve on the Post-Gazette's executive committee and on the Block Communications Inc. board of directors.
She has been with the paper since 1998, starting as a reporter.
Also announced yesterday, John Robinson Block, the newspaper's publisher and editor-in-chief, has been named chairman of the Post-Gazette.
